Subject: Flaky DNS in Burrowgate resolvers — fix shipping

Plugin authors: intermittent resolution failures against the Burrowgate internal resolvers have been traced to a stale negative-cache TTL. Fix lands in tonight's rollout. Until then, plugins doing their own lookups should retry once with a 2s delay rather than failing hard. No config changes needed on your side. Report anything still flaky after the rollout. The build carrying the fix is referenced below.

session token of tajef-bageg = htk21_5d90d574934f3ccae6437

# Loadtest env for the Pennygate checkout flow.
# Targets the Sableford staging cluster only — never point this at prod.
# RAMP_USERS and TEST_DURATION control the run; defaults simulate a
# modest sale-day spike. Synthetic payment calls are authenticated,
# and the test token is set on the next line.

env line for kajep-bahip: LEDGER_TOKEN29=99b839f98891c2049d3cfc2138cb5

Handover — Fare Experiment v2 (Tessa → Rohan)

Hey Rohan, quick brain-dump before I'm out. The Skylark ticket-pricing experiment is at 20% traffic; variant B (dynamic weekend bump) is winning on revenue but watch the refund rate, it crept up Tuesday. Dashboards are in the usual folder. Don't promote to 50% until the release manager signs off on the guardrail review Friday. Config flags live in the pricing vault — if you need to tweak the bump ceiling, unlock it with the recovery passphrase below.

unlock words, yawig-kagef: gordor-holvan-ulaael-pramir-ulaiel-tamdor

TURN-208: Gatevale turnstile counters at the Merrow Field pilot double-count when a rotation reverses mid-cycle. Attendance totals drift roughly 2% high per event. The debounce window fix is implemented, reviewed by Ilsa, and soak-tested across two simulated match days without drift. Ready for your cut; the candidate build is identified below.

trace token, tagag-tafog: htk6_5ed18c

v3.7.1 — Rotated the signing key used by Confluxa's hot-reload subsystem. Config bundles pushed after 02:00 UTC must be signed with the new key or the watcher will reject the reload and keep serving the previous config. No restart is required; the watcher picks up correctly signed bundles automatically. If reloads fail after this release, re-sign the bundle and push again. The new signing key is as follows.

rollout seal: bky9_PeXH1fTLY